      There was no documented expectation for support of CQL within CDex and none is planned.  We're not sure exactly what the scope boundary concerns are.  However, we will re-write the CDex intro page to more clearly highlight the three specific technical exchange mechanisms supported: direct query, use of Task to specify a query to be executed asynchronously, and use of Task to specify a code or codes describing documentation to be returned asynchronously.

      Comment:

      While for the CQL and document query components we are comfortable with the document and would approve, since the scope is defined well beyond that, there is substantial work to be done to address that additional scope. We suggest that the scope is clarified to understand what the target is for STU 1.0.0 and provide comments accordingly..
